New Land Rover Discovery Sport priced at Rs 67.9 lakh
The updated model gets a new Pivi Pro 11.4-inch infotainment touchscreen along with feature updates.
Land Rover India has announced prices for the 2024 Discovery Sport – the updated seven-seater is priced at Rs 67.9 lakh, ex-showroom, India. The Discovery Sport continues to be available in a single higher-spec trim, Dynamic SE, and gets two engine options – a 249hp, 2.0-litre turbo-petrol unit and a 204hp, 2.0-litre diesel, which are both priced the same. The seven-seat luxury SUV costs about Rs 5 lakh less than the outgoing model.
2024 Land Rover Discovery Sport interior: what’s new
Most of the changes seen on the updated Discovery Sport are to the features list. The most obvious difference is the new (and larger) Pivi Pro 11.4-inch infotainment touchscreen that is mounted centrally on the dash and gets updates to its OS. Wireless Apple CarPlay has also been added to the list of features, along with two USB-C chargers in each row, a 12V socket in the second row and boot, and climate control for the third row.
The interior continues to feature a digital driver display, 360-degree cameras including a dedicated rear view mirror display, steering-mounted paddleshifters, reclining and sliding rear seats with a 40:20:40 split-folding function, and a panoramic sunroof. Land Rover offers two colour options for the insides, Duo Leather upholstery, and a natural shadow oak trim finish around the gear knob.
2024 Land Rover Discovery Sport exterior: what’s new
The Discovery Sport badge now comes with a gloss black finish, as does the grille, lower body sills, and lower bumpers. The front bumper also gets a claw-like detailing in gloss black. The British luxury brand has added a new Varesine Blue exterior finish to the Discovery Sport’s portfolio, and there are new 19-inch alloy wheels on offer too.
2024 Land Rover Discovery Sport price: rivals
Compared to competitors in this luxury SUV space, such as the BMW X3 (Rs 68.5 lakh-72.5 lakh), Audi Q5 (Rs 65.18 lakh-70.45 lakh), Volvo XC60 (Rs 68.9 lakh) and the Mercedes-Benz GLC (Rs 74.2 lakh-75.2 lakh), the updated Discovery Sport undercuts all its rivals other than the entry-level Audi.
All prices, ex-showroom, India
